Dubai Autodrome
The Dubai Autodrome was the second desert-based track to emerge in the early 2000s, and has now become a hub for motorsport in the region. TF Sport will make their debut at the Dubai Autodrome, at the opening round of the 2021 Asian Le Mans Series.

Abu Dhabi
At a cost of over a billion dollars, Yas Marina Circuit is constructed on the man-made Yas Island near to Abu Dhabi and first hosted a Grand Prix in 2009. It has been the home of the Gulf 12 Hours since 2011 in a race that is unusual in that it features two stints of six hours with a break in the middle.
The circuit itself features two very long straights between turns seven and 11 separated by a chicane which is designed to aid passing in race conditions. No stone has been left unturned in creating a state-of-the-art racing facility from the air-conditioned pit garages to the fully-covered grandstands.
